Episode Synopsis


The mental health crisis in the construction industry has reached a fever pitch. Dee & Brad review some alarming figures and discuss the many contributing factors to stress in the industry as well as some very personal stories. This episode speaks to everyone in the industry from the first year apprentice to trade contractors, GCs, and Owners and is a must listen. There is much we can do to contribute to being part of the solution, and it starts with each and every one of us.

Takeaways
Mental health is a significant concern in construction.
The suicide rate in construction is alarmingly high.
Substance abuse is prevalent due to stress and work culture.
Celebrating successes is often overlooked in the industry.
Construction work is inherently dangerous and stressful.
Opioids and alcohol are linked to a high percentage of suicides.
The industry culture often demands constant change and overwork.
Communication has decreased despite advancements in technology.
The pace of construction is increasing, leading to burnout.
Prolonged stress can lead to serious health issues. The impact of past experiences on current feelings about work.
Many in the construction industry leave due to stress.
Effective communication is crucial in high-stress environments.
Building rapport helps in difficult conversations.
Understanding personality types can improve communication.
High D personalities may overlook others' feelings.
Mental health is a significant safety concern in construction.
Prioritizing people can lead to better business outcomes.
Communication training is essential for reducing stress.
Creating a supportive culture can improve employee retention.
